Skip to content

Instantly share code, notes, and snippets.

View jcbombardelli's full-sized avatar
:shipit:
Ever Focusing

JC Bombardelli jcbombardelli

:shipit:
Ever Focusing
View GitHub Profile
const pokemons = [135, 7, 123, 86, 26, 132 ]
const promises = pokemons.map(id => {
return fetch(`https://pokeapi.co/api/v2/pokemon/${id}`)
})
Promise.all(promises)
.then(res => {
return Promise.all(res.map(r => r.json()))
})

Backend Developer Challenge 👩‍💻

Objetivo 🥅

Parte do nosso trabalho e propósito aqui na Gama é encontrar e recrutar pessoas que tenham talento, prepará-las para as empresas parceiras treinando-as para que já cheguem o mais capacitadas o possível para os novos desafios. Mas para isso precisamos primeiro criar um critério de seleção que seja o mais rápido e fácil levando em consideração volume e tempo que nossos parceiros têm para preencher suas vagas em suas empresas. A forma para conseguir isso é através de uma prova que meça habilidades e competências técnicas.

@jcbombardelli
jcbombardelli / index.js
Created December 29, 2020 15:16
Proof of concept to use mongodb with moongose in atlasdb
const mongoose = require("mongoose");
const run = async () => {
const uri = `mongodb+srv://<username>:<password>@<host>/<database>?retryWrites=true&w=majority`;
await mongoose.connect(uri, { useNewUrlParser: true, useUnifiedTopology: true });
const User = mongoose.model("users", new mongoose.Schema({ name: String }));
const result = await User.find({})
@jcbombardelli
jcbombardelli / whitelist.json
Last active December 10, 2020 22:41
whitelist-saas-gama-academy
["jc.bombardelli@live.com"]
curl -sL https://deb.nodesource.com/setup_10.x | sudo -E bash -
sudo apt install nodejs
public class Carro {
private String cor;
private int anoFabricacao;
private int qtdPortas;
private String combustivel;
private String marca;
private String placa;
private int assentos;
const PrivateKeyProvider = require('@truffle/hdwallet-provider');
const privateKeys = [
"c87509a1c067bbde78beb793e6fa76530b6382a4c0241e5e4a9ec0a0f44dc0d3"
]
module.exports = {
networks: {
besu: {
{
"config": {
"chainId": 2020,
"constantinoplefixblock": 0,
"clique": {
"blockperiodseconds": 15,
"epochlength": 30000
}
},
"parentHash": "0x0000000000000000000000000000000000000000000000000000000000000000",
@jcbombardelli
jcbombardelli / Animal.java
Last active May 8, 2020 20:15
Dia 5 curso java Orientação a Objetos Herança , Polimorfismo e Interfaces
public class Animal {
private double tamanho; // em centimetros
private double peso; // em kgs
private String cor;
private String raca;
private String especie;
private boolean agressivo;
public void setCor(String novaCor) {
@jcbombardelli
jcbombardelli / Animal.java
Last active May 8, 2020 20:11
Exemplos apresentado no dia 04 do curso de Java
package zoologico;
public class Animal {
private double tamanho; // em centimetros
private double peso; // em kgs
private String cor;
private String raca;
private String especie;
private boolean agressivo;